Nosy Be: 10 Breathtaking Beaches You Must Visit

Nosy Be

Nosy Be, a small island located off the northwest coast of Madagascar, is known as the “Perfumed Island” for its fragrant ylang-ylang plantations. But beyond its aromatic charm lies something even more captivating—its beaches. Dotted with turquoise waters, powdery white sands, and swaying palm trees, Nosy Be offers some of the most stunning coastlines in […]